    Hey all, back for a quick update.

    So as one of my potential solutions, I'm going to be looking into implementing a spec-based loot system. That is, if you receive loot as a tank, it will be tank-oriented. The same goes for dps and healers (although at this point there is not a huge difference between those two). It seems like something that we would capable of doing, it just may take a bit of time on my end.

    I do, however, realize that this is only a partial solution to the issues that many of you are having with RNG, so I do not plan on stopping there, and need to work some things out over here to figure out what the next best step would be. I appreciate all of the feedback so far, and I want you to know that I will be taking it into consideration as I iron out some of the remaining details.

    So to clarify on a few things, if this went in, much like with class-specific loot, it would also look at your current primary trait-line to determine your role. Since I'm pretty familiar with the Guardian, I'll use that as an example:

    Defender of the Free: Tank
    Keen Blade: DPS
    Fighter of Shadow: Tank

    Based on this role, it would then provide a piece of gear with role-specific states (or set bonuses). The way that I believe it functions right now, is that you could theoretically switch trait lines before claiming/looting, and you would be provided with gear relevant to that spec (a feature I'm not necessarily opposed to). HOWEVER, I still need to play around with things a bit. Also, the intent would be to have this in more sooner than later, but I can't give definites on a release yet.
